Agent Reviewer (Code)
Runs parallel external agent reviews on code implementation, critically verifies suggestions, returns filtered improvements.
Purpose & Scope
- Worker in ln-510 quality coordinator pipeline (invoked by ln-510 Phase 4)
- Run codex-review + gemini-review as background tasks in parallel
- Process results as they arrive (first-finished agent processed immediately)
- Critically verify each suggestion; debate with agent if Claude disagrees
- Return filtered, deduplicated, verified suggestions with confidence scoring
- Health check + prompt execution in single invocation
When to Use
- Invoked by ln-510-quality-coordinator Phase 4 (Agent Review)
- All implementation tasks in Story status = Done
- Code quality (ln-511) and tech debt cleanup (ln-512) already completed

Critical Verification + Debate (per Debate Protocol in
shared/references/agent_delegation_pattern.md):For EACH suggestion from agent results:
a) Claude Evaluation: Independently assess — is the issue real? Actionable? Conflicts with project patterns?
b) AGREE → accept as-is. DISAGREE/UNCERTAIN → initiate challenge.
c) Challenge + Follow-Up (with session resume): Follow Debate Protocol (Challenge Round 1 → Follow-Up Round if not resolved). Resume agent's review session for full context continuity:
- Read
session_idfrom.agent-review/{agent}/{identifier}_session.json - Run with
--resume-session {session_id}— agent continues in same session, preserving file analysis and reasoning - If
session_resumed: falsein result → log warning, result still valid (stateless fallback) {review_type}= "Code Implementation"- Challenge files:
.agent-review/{agent}/{identifier}_codereview_challenge_{N}_prompt.md/_result.md - Follow-up files:
.agent-review/{agent}/{identifier}_codereview_followup_{N}_prompt.md/_result.md
d) Persist: all challenge and follow-up prompts/results in
.agent-review/{agent}/- Read
Aggregate + Return: Collect ACCEPTED suggestions only (after verification + debate).
Deduplicate by(area, issue)— keep higher confidence.
Filter:confidence >= 90ANDimpact_percent > 2.
Return JSON with suggestions + agent_stats + debate_log to parent skill. NO cleanup/deletion.

final_resolution: "rejected"Fallback Rules
| Condition | Action |
|---|---|
| Both agents succeed | Aggregate verified suggestions from both |
| One agent fails | Use successful agent's verified suggestions, log failure |
| Both agents fail | Return {verdict: "SKIPPED", reason: "agents failed"} |
| Parent skill (ln-510) | Falls back to Self-Review (native Claude) |
Verdict Escalation
- Findings with
area=securityorarea=correctness-> parent skill can escalate PASS -> CONCERNS - This skill returns raw verified suggestions; escalation decision is made by ln-510
Critical Rules
- Read-only review — agents must NOT modify project files (enforced by prompt CRITICAL CONSTRAINTS)
- Same prompt to all agents (identical input for fair comparison)
- JSON output schema required from agents (via
--json/--output-format json) - Log all attempts for user visibility (agent name, duration, suggestion count)
- Persist prompts, results, and challenge artifacts in
.agent-review/{agent}/— do NOT delete - Ensure
.agent-review/.gitignoreexists before creating files (only create if.agent-review/is new) - MANDATORY INVOCATION: Parent skills MUST invoke this skill. Returns SKIPPED gracefully if agents unavailable. Parent must NOT pre-check and skip.
- NO TIMEOUT KILL — WAIT FOR RESPONSE: Do NOT kill agent background tasks. WAIT until agent completes and delivers its response — do NOT proceed without it, do NOT use TaskStop. Agents are instructed to respond within 10 minutes via prompt constraint, but the hard behavior is: wait for completion or crash. Only a hard crash (non-zero exit code, connection error) is treated as failure. TaskStop is FORBIDDEN for agent tasks.
- CRITICAL VERIFICATION: Do NOT trust agent suggestions blindly. Claude MUST independently verify each suggestion and debate if disagreeing. Accept only after verification.
